#633d95 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#633d95 is composed of 38.8% red, 23.9% green and 58.4%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 33.6% cyan, 59.1% magenta, 0% yellow and 41.6% black. It has a hue angle of 265.9 degrees, a saturation of 41.9% and a lightness of 41.2%. #633d95 color hex could be obtained by blending #c67aff with #00002b. Closest websafe color is: #663399.

#633d95 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#633d95 has RGB values of R:99, G:61, B:149 and CMYK values of C:0.34, M:0.59, Y:0, K:0.42. Its decimal value is 6503829.

Shades and Tints of #633d95
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#07040a is the darkest color, while #fcfbfd is the lightest one.

Tones of #633d95
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#69656d is the less saturated color, while #5b04ce is the most saturated one.
